Last Listing description (October 2023)

Boasting an exclusive Richmond Hill address, this stylishly renovated Victorian is a sanctuary of light and space in the most convenient of locations, just footsteps to vibrant Swan Street, public transport and schools

- Traditional Victorian appeal and charm meets contemporary style & space at this renovated and extended home in a prized pocket of Richmond.
- A cosy gas fireplace is the focal point of the open plan living/dining zone which embraces a sophisticated gourmet kitchen with designer European oven, crisp white benchtops and glossy cabinetry.
- There are three sizable bedrooms across the home’s two light-lavished levels, including a study or optional 4th bedroom and a master with a spacious walk-in robe or optional nursery, ensuite & wide private terrace with far-reaching city views.
- Two robed ground-floor bedrooms share a bright main bathroom while a study with workstation and a European-style laundry are invaluable inclusions.
- Beautiful, polished floors are a highlight, and the home also features 14 Jinko Solar Tiger Neo solar panels w/ enphase inverters, air-conditioning, an alarm, roof storage and high ceilings with clerestory windows.
- Low maintenance entertainers garden with outdoor lighting and gas fittings for an undercover BBQ, easy-to-maintain courtyard/parking space with secure roller door access.

With the retail, dining and transport options along Swan Street and close by, this coveted locale is moments of Melbourne’s sporting precinct and Yarra trails. In the zone for Melbourne Girls’ College and Richmond Primary School, with easy access to esteemed private schools and minutes away from the CBD. 14 Wangaratta Street offers a quick and easy commute for all members of the family.

About Richmond 3121

The size of Richmond is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 4.9% of total area. The population of Richmond in 2011 was 23,814 people. By 2016 the population was 27,711 showing a population growth of 16.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Richmond is 20-29 years. Households in Richmond are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Richmond work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 43.2% of the homes in Richmond were owner-occupied compared with 40.8% in 2016.

Richmond has 22,304 properties.
